Final Appeal and Boast in the Cross

Galatians 6:11-18

6
Chapter 6
11 See with what large letters I have written to you with my own hand. 12 As many as want to make a good showing in the flesh, these compel you to be circumcised, only in order that they might not be persecuted for the cross of Christ. 13 For even those who are circumcised do not keep the Law themselves, but they want you to be circumcised so that they might boast in your flesh. 14 But may it never happen to me to boast except in the cross of our Lord Jesus Christ, through whom the world has been crucified to me, and I to the world. 15 For neither circumcision is anything nor uncircumcision, but a new creation. 16 And as many as walk by this rule, peace be upon them and mercy, and upon the Israel of God. 17 From now on, let no one cause me troubles, for I bear the marks of Jesus in my body. 18 The grace of our Lord Jesus Christ be with your spirit, brothers. Amen.
